Size: a a a

2017 May 19

PT

Pavel Tkachenko in Rubyata
У них простейшая АПИ
источник

PT

Pavel Tkachenko in Rubyata
источник

PT

Pavel Tkachenko in Rubyata
Можешь обертку за 10 минут написать
источник

DO

Denis Oster in Rubyata
Она работает с nodejs. sms отпправлет
источник

DO

Denis Oster in Rubyata
А как внедрить  в рельсы
источник

PT

Pavel Tkachenko in Rubyata
У них же REST API
источник

PT

Pavel Tkachenko in Rubyata
Я ссылку
источник

PT

Pavel Tkachenko in Rubyata
да
источник

PT

Pavel Tkachenko in Rubyata
дал
источник

DO

Denis Oster in Rubyata
да читал.
источник

PT

Pavel Tkachenko in Rubyata
Самый простой способ:
источник

PT

Pavel Tkachenko in Rubyata
Создай папочку /services в /app
источник

DO

Denis Oster in Rubyata
ага
источник

PT

Pavel Tkachenko in Rubyata
назови например sms_bsg_world.rb
источник

DO

Denis Oster in Rubyata
"use strict";
var bsg = require( 'bsg-nodejs' )( 'мой код акаунта' );

bsg.createSMS(
       {
               destination: "phone",
               originator:"testsms",
               body:"message text",
               msisdn:"номер получателя",
               reference:"уникальный_id",
               validity:"1",
               tariff:"9"
       }
).then(
       SMS => console.log( "SMS created:", SMS ),
       error => console.log( "SMS creation failed:", error )
);
источник

DO

Denis Oster in Rubyata
Это для  nodejs
источник

PT

Pavel Tkachenko in Rubyata
Ну так это обертка же
источник

PT

Pavel Tkachenko in Rubyata
Тебе придется самому написать обертку
источник

PT

Pavel Tkachenko in Rubyata
module SmsBsgWorld
 class Send
   def initalize(text:, phone_number:)
@text = text
@phone_number = phone_number
   end
 end
end
источник

PT

Pavel Tkachenko in Rubyata
И пошел
источник